Commercial Tree Trimming in Allentown, PA
Commercial tree trimming services involve the careful pruning and shaping of trees on residential properties to promote healthy growth, improve appearance, and ensure safety. This service typically covers a range of projects, including removing dead or diseased branches, thinning dense canopies, and reducing the height or spread of trees to prevent potential hazards. Property owners often request tree trimming to maintain the aesthetic appeal of their landscape, prevent interference with structures or power lines, and support the overall health of their trees.
Before requesting commercial tree trimming, property owners should consider the specific needs of their trees, such as identifying problematic branches or understanding the desired shape and size. It is also helpful to assess the location of trees in relation to buildings, walkways, and utility lines to determine the scope of work required. Clear communication about the objectives and any safety concerns can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s landscape management goals.

Common Commercial Tree Trimming Jobs
Commercial Tree Trimming Services - Pruning overgrown branches to maintain tree health and safety.
Tree Crown Reduction - Reducing the size of tree canopies to prevent interference with structures or power lines.
Emergency Tree Trimming - Removing damaged or hazardous limbs after storms or severe weather events.
Tree Shaping and Thinning - Improving air circulation and light penetration within the tree canopy.
Utility Line Clearance - Trimming trees to ensure safe distance from power lines and prevent outages.
Site Clearing and Brush Removal - Clearing trees and debris for new construction or landscaping projects.
Commercial Tree Trimming Questions
What types of trees are suitable for commercial trimming? Most deciduous and evergreen trees on commercial properties can benefit from trimming to maintain health and appearance.
Why is regular tree trimming important for businesses? Regular trimming helps prevent hazards, promotes healthy growth, and enhances the overall landscape aesthetics.
What are common reasons for requesting commercial tree trimming? Property owners often request trimming for safety, clearance, disease control, or to improve the view and curb appeal.
How does commercial tree trimming differ from residential services? Commercial trimming typically involves larger trees and more extensive work to meet safety standards and landscape requirements.
